Summary

Researchers achieve groundbreaking quantum teleportation by successfully transferring quantum information 270 meters between quantum dots using three photons, marking a major milestone toward building secure global quantum internet networks.

Key Points

  • Researchers successfully teleport quantum information between two separate quantum dots located 270 meters apart, overcoming a major obstacle for quantum internet development
  • The breakthrough uses three photons - two entangled ones from the first quantum dot and a third from a different source - to transfer quantum states without destroying the original information
  • This achievement brings quantum relays closer to reality, potentially enabling secure global quantum networks that can move information across vast distances through teleportation
